CAD Training

The computer aided design program at Northeast Mississippi Community College prepares students for careers as mechanical drafter or other areas of manufacturing such as design, engineering, and management. The program focuses on applying technical skills to create working drawings and computer simulations for a variety of applications. Program courses include: specification interpretation, dimensioning techniques, drafting circulations, material estimation, technical communications, computer applications, and interpersonal communications. About
Northeast Mississippi Community College, located in Booneville, Mississippi, was founded in 1948 and was originally known as Northeast Mississippi Community College.The school's land was sold to the state with the purpose that a college be build upon it. The school took its current name in 1987 and currently maintains a five county service area that includes Alcorn, Prentiss, Tishomingo, Tippah, and Union. The school is one of fifteen in the state of Mississippi and also has two extension centers in Corinth and New Albany.

Academics
NEMCC is a comprehensive community college that offers programs and services that allow students to obtain academic transfer or career training. Career training programs provide education in a specific industry or field, often in demand locally, allowing the student to enter the workforce as a qualified professional upon completion. Programs typically take between one and two years to complete, conferring a degree or certificate upon completion. Academic transfer programs provide a curriculum that completes the first two years of a four year education followed by transfer to a four year college or university to complete the final two years and earn their bachelor's degree.

Admissions and Financial Aid
Students who wish to enroll at NEMCC may do so may by submitting a completed application for admission and paying all associated fees. Students should supply previous transcripts and test scores and may be required to take a placement exam prior to registration. Financial aid is available in the form of loans, scholarships and grants which are awarded based on need. A student's need is determined by the by the information on their Free Application for Federal Student Aid (FAFSA). Aid must be applied for prior to each academic year.

Career Options for Graduates

Upon completion of the CAD program at Northeast Mississippi Community College, most students have pursued careers in the following fields:

Architectural Drafters

Description

Prepare detailed drawings of architectural designs and plans for buildings and structures according to specifications provided by architect.

Career Outlook & Projections ()

According to the BLS, architectural drafters employment is expected to shrink at a rate of -3.0% from 2014 to 2024

Electronic Drafters

Description

Draw wiring diagrams, circuit board assembly diagrams, schematics, and layout drawings used for manufacture, installation, and repair of electronic equipment.

Career Outlook & Projections ()

According to the BLS, electronic drafters employment is expected to grow at a rate of 5.4% from 2014 to 2024

Mechanical Drafters

Description

Prepare detailed working diagrams of machinery and mechanical devices, including dimensions, fastening methods, and other engineering information.

Career Outlook & Projections ()

According to the BLS, mechanical drafters employment is expected to shrink at a rate of -6.8% from 2014 to 2024

Drafters, All Other

Description

All drafters not listed separately.

Career Outlook & Projections ()

According to the BLS, drafters, all other employment is expected to shrink at a rate of -3.4% from 2014 to 2024
